The nightly search reindex for Quellhaven runs at 02:10 UTC and rebuilds the full Lanternfield catalog index before traffic ramps up in the Veldora region. The release manager should confirm the reindex job completed before tagging a build, since stale shards will fail the smoke suite. The job authenticates against the internal Indexweaver service using a dedicated credential. For release validation, use the key below.

gateway credential: kto23_LX9A4ys6i4nzHtpOLNLodKK

Welcome aboard! Quick context for your review: last quarter's stale-cache bug in Fernwick's lookup layer came from the Pellet service serving expired tenant configs after a TTL misfire. The postmortem doc covers the fix, but you'll want to poke at the cache invalidation path yourself. To replay the incident traffic against the staging Pellet instance, you'll need to authenticate, so use the key below.

API key for tagef-fafop: vxb2-ta

// Tide predictions come from the Selkirk Bay almanac feed, which
// updates every six hours; polling faster than this just burns quota.
// The widget interpolates between samples client-side, so a longer
// interval does not make the chart look stale. Do not set below 300:
// the feed rate-limits hard and the Moonharrow dashboard goes blank
// for everyone. If you change this, update the Harbourlight test
// fixtures too. The constant was last verified against the build
// recorded immediately below.

pipeline stamp: htk9_ce63042d9

Hey dispatch — logging a missed pick-up from yesterday. The uniform boxes for the new Gorseley depot were sitting by the loading door all afternoon, but nobody from Pimlett Couriers ever showed. No call, nothing in the booking system either, so not sure where the wires got crossed. The depot opens Monday and the crews really need their kit before then, so can we rebook for tomorrow morning, first run if possible? One more thing — the hand-over instruction for the courier is below.

handover note for yagef-bagep: the drudor pelius courier leaves the kasdor zorvan norir ledger at gate 8016 under passcode 755406